About us
Anomify.ai is building intelligent solutions that help organisations detect, understand, and act on events in complex data environments. Our small founding team has spent the last 18 months in research and development mode - working on two core products: Anomify, our ML-powered anomaly detection platform, and Hyperfence.io, a deterministic security layer for AI, LLMs and agents. We’re building novel solutions for some of the most nascent problems, operating at the cutting edge of monitoring.
